Brown-Driver-Briggs
[מַשֶּׁה] noun masculine loan; — only construct שָׁמוֺט כָּלֿ בַּעַל מַשֵּׁה יָדוֺ אֲשֶׁר יַשֶּׁה בְּרֵעֵהוּ Deuteronomy 15:2 every possessor of a loan of his hand shall renounce what he lends to his neighbour (compare Dr).
